Art Community Pays Heartfelt Tribute to Debadatta Puhan Through Candlelight Rally Following His Untimely Passing

Bhubaneswar,  Aug 19 [UDN}:Debadatta Puhan, popularly known as Tutuna Bhai, a young art enthusiast from Tulasipur village under Gandhan Gram Panchayat of Rasulpur block. Art directors, artists and more than a hundred art lovers from the Kuakhia area took part in the rally on Monday night.
Led by theatre director Narayan Chandra Sahu, the artists gathered near Maa Tarini Temple at Kuakhia market. A condolence meeting was held there, where tributes were paid and memories of Debadatta were recalled. Later, the participants carried candles and marched through the market, raising slogans such as “Tutuna Bhai Amar Rahe” (Long Live Tutuna Bhai).
The condolence meeting was attended by theatre director Narahari Nayak, theatre artists Laxmikanta Satapathy and Satyananda SahanI, social worker Kalandi Charan Jena, Shivasundar Das, Bijay Barik, Pavitra Rath, Akshaya Mishra, Abhimanyu Mishra, Sudhakar Palei, Kishore Chandra SahanI, Shantanu Sahu and Kalandi Kar, among others.
